Understanding RTP in Online Slots: A Player’s Guide

When you start spinning reels at online casinos, understanding Return to Player (RTP) percentages can significantly impact your gaming experience. RTP represents the average amount a slot machine returns to players over time, expressed as a percentage of all wagered money.

What Does RTP Really Mean?

An online slot with a 96% RTP doesn’t guarantee you’ll win 96% of your bets. Instead, it means that theoretically, for every $100 wagered across millions of spins, the game returns $96 to players collectively. This metric helps you identify which slots offer better long-term value compared to others.

Volatility Matters Too

RTP only tells part of the story. Volatility, or variance, determines how often and how much you’ll win. Low volatility slots pay frequently with smaller wins, while high volatility games offer bigger payouts but less frequently.
